Transaction fdd4f8edbcb106e68a44880a452ceebb38f7d2e5ad1959af0a88eaf1abf21b3e

1 Input
2 Outputs
  • fdd4f8edbcb106e68a44880a452ceebb38f7d2e5ad1959af0a88eaf1abf21b3e:0
  • value  5000000
    address  3884odhxh2G2nyZYmHoThU2a392qxbhv9S
  • fdd4f8edbcb106e68a44880a452ceebb38f7d2e5ad1959af0a88eaf1abf21b3e:1
  • value  333140712
    address  1Hgbt8ZGj9xxNgfCeK9knsbMnQrp2S9rPj